Cafgu shoots cop, two civilians in Negros village fiesta

BACOLOD CITY - A policeman and two civilians, including a teenager, were wounded after they were shot by a member of the Civilian Armed Forces Geographical Unit (Cafgu) in a fiesta in Barangay Alimango, Escalante City, Negros Occidental on Saturday, July 1. ....

Traffic enforcer shot dead in Escalante City

BACOLOD CITY - A traffic enforcer was gunned down in front a public high school in Barangay Alimango, Escalante City, Negros Occidental on Wednesday, Oct. 5.

Teenage girl drowns in Negros beach resort

BACOLOD CITY – A 15-year-old girl drowned in a beach resort in Barangay Alimango, Escalante City, Negros Occidental Wednesday, July 20.

Escalante City mayor defends NTF-ELCAC funds for villages

SUPPORT FOR BDP. Mayor Melecio Yap Jr. of Escalante City, Negros Occidental defends the budget for the Barangay Development Program of the National Task Force to End Local Communist Armed Conflict, which has benefited 14 insurgency-cleared villages in his city. "I challenge all those legislators who want to defund the NTF-ELCAC, the PHP280 million is with us. You can come here, you can scrutinize these projects," Yap said in a video message posted by the Philippine Army's 3rd Infantry Division on Thursday (Nov. 25, 2021).(Screenshot from 3rd Infantry Division, Philippine Army video) BACOLOD CITY - Mayor Melecio Yap Jr. of Escalante City, Negros Occidental on Thursday defended the proposed budget for the Barangay Development Program (BDP) of the National Task Force to End Local Communist Armed Conflict (NTF-ELCAC) after some senators pushed for reduced funding next year. BDP-funded road opens opportunities for NegOcc town villagers

MORE OPPORTUNITIES. The ongoing concreting of the Alimango-Lawis Road in Barangay Alimango, Escalante City, Negros Occidental. The improvement of the village's farm-to-market road is funded through the Barangay Development Program of the National Task Force to End Local Communist Armed Conflict.(Photo courtesy of 303rd Infantry Brigade, Philippine Army) BACOLOD CITY - More opportunities await residents of Barangay Alimango in Escalante City, Negros Occidental with the improvement of the village's farm-to-market road funded through the Barangay Development Program (BDP) of the National Task Force to End Local Communist Armed Conflict (NTF-ELCAC). The PHP17.5-million concreting of the Alimango-Lawis Road is ongoing, but the ceremonial groundbreaking was held in Sitio Lawis only on Wednesday after several delays due to restrictions posed by the coronavirus disease 2019 (Covid-19) pandemic.
